The main suspect linked to the murder of 30-year-old Wits University student Olerato Mongale has been shot and killed by police in a shootout in Amanzimtoti, south of Durban.
Police say that when they located Philangenkosi Makhanya, he opened fire on officers, who returned fire, fatally wounding him on the scene.
Makhanya was one of three men wanted in connection with Mongale’s murder. The other two suspects, Fezile Ngubane and Bongani Mthimkhulu, remain at large.
Mongale’s body was discovered last Sunday after it had been dumped near Alexandra township in northern Johannesburg.
KwaZulu-Natal Police Commissioner Lieutenant General Nhlanhla Mkhwanazi said officers had worked around the clock to track down the prime suspect.
“Our teams acted swiftly and decisively after receiving information about Makhanya’s whereabouts,” said Mkhwanazi.
Police have urged anyone with information on the whereabouts of Ngubane and Mthimkhulu to come forward.
